"بزرگترین گناه این است که خود را ضعیف تصور کنی"
— Swami Vivekananda
Simplified Meaning:
When you believe you are weak, you limit yourself. Thinking that you cannot do something stops you from trying. Imagine a young athlete who dreams of winning a race but thinks they are too slow. Because of this belief, they might skip practice or not push themselves, leading to a self-fulfilling prophecy where they indeed don’t win. However, if the athlete believes in their potential and trains hard, they increase their chances of success. By thinking you are stronger and capable, you push past limits and achieve more. This mindset helps you face challenges bravely, work harder, and reach your goals.
